Sparkplugs said:I just got my package for BMQ in the mail yesterday, and in it was a sheet of paper explaining pay and allowances for a private basic. I'll type them out here for you, just for your own reference.
Single:
Pay rate: 2421.00
Supplemental death benefits: 5.85
Employment Insurance: 47.21
CF Pension and CPP: 203.44
SISSIP/LTD: 5.07
Income Taxes: 415.51
Sales tax: 0.53
Single quarters: 74.00
Rations: 365.61
Total deductions: 1117.22
Net take home pay: 1303.78
Married:
Pay rate: 2421.00
Supplemental death benefits: 5.85
Employment Insurance: 47.21
CF Pension and CPP: 203.44
SISSIP/LTD: 5.07
Income Taxes: 415.51
Sales tax: 0.53
Single quarters: N/A
Rations: N/A
Total deductions: 677.61
Net take home pay: 2088.39
Hope that helps!
